Preparation To Make of Spaghetti Bolognese (Beef):
  1. Get Bolognese Sauce
  2. Make ready 300 grams minced beef
  3. Prepare 250 grams chicken liver
  4. Take 1 1/2 tbsp olive oil
  5. Prepare 1 clove garlic, peeled
  6. Make ready 1/2 tbsp parsley
  7. Get 1 bay leaf
  8. Take 1 can tomatoes
  9. Get 150 ml water
  10. Get 1 beef stock cube
  11. Get 2 tbsp tomato puree
  12. Prepare 1 salt and pepper
  13. Make ready 1/2 tsp chopped basil
  14. Make ready 25 grams butter
  15. Make ready 1 grated parmesan cheese
  16. Make ready Spaghetti
  17. Make ready 1 water
  18. Make ready 1 tsp olive oil
  19. Make ready 25 grams melted butter
  20. Get 1 tbsp salt
  21. Take 500 grams Italian Spaghetti

Instructions To Make Spaghetti Bolognese (Beef):
  1. Soak chicken livers in a pot of salted water for 30 mins or more.
  2. Combine minced beef, garlic, onion, parsley and bay leaf into a saucepan.
  3. Using a scissors or knife, cut chicken livers into small pieces, removing membranes. Dry the chicken liver pieces by placing them on paper towels. Add chicken liver to saucepan.
  4. Using medium heat, brown meat slowly, stirring frequently.
  5. When mixture is thoroughly cooked with no remaining water, remove garlic clove.
  6. Add canned tomatoes, beef stock cube, water, tomato puree and season to taste. Stir well.
  7. Simmer the sauce for up to 45 minutes, until it is of a suitable consistency.
  8. To cook spaghetti: Fill large saucepan with plenty of water. Add salt and olive oil and bring to a boil. Slowly dip spaghetti into the boiling water. As it softens, curl it around the pan until it is all submerged. Cook until tender but firm - according to packet directions. Remove from heat and drain pasta in a colander immediately. Coat with the melted butter and serve immediately.
  9. Stir in the basil, and simmer for 1 minute.
  10. Remove saucepan from heat, and add butter. Stir.
  11. When spaghetti is ready, serve a spoonful of sauce on top and add parmesan cheese to taste.
